RTL, Liberty Reject Efforts by Copyright Agencies to Settle Dispute in EU

(Bloomberg) -- RTL Group SA, Deutsche Telekom AG,
Liberty Global Inc. and two dozen competitors asked European
Union regulators to reject an offer by national royalty-
collection agencies to settle an antitrust case.

The agencies, which collect performance and broadcast fees
on behalf of artists and composers, offered to drop some
restrictions on the licenses they sell to address EU concerns
they break competition rules. RTL, Europe's biggest broadcaster
and a unit of Germany's Bertelsmann AG, has complained that the
proposal is inadequate because key rights remain in the hands of
the 27 separate national groups.
